56:11-40  Obtaining information under false pretenses, fourth degree crime.

13.  Any person who knowingly and willfully obtains information on a consumer from a consumer reporting agency under false pretenses shall be guilty of a crime of the fourth degree.

L.1997,c.172,s.13.
